On Feb. 1, 2015, an audience of more than 114 million were able to watch craft beer get insulted over and over. It was during that secularly sacred national coming-together known as the Super Bowl, where 30 seconds of advertising cost sponsors an average of $4.25 million. Anheuser-Busch InBev, the world’s largest brewer, had that kind of money, and it hired advertising house Anomaly to help it train an especially snarky attack on craft beer.

On Nov. 18, 1988, President Ronald Reagan signed into law a requirement that alcohol producers slap a 41-word label on their packaging warning consumers that their product could cause accidents and health problems, including birth defects. By the end of the decade, every producer would comply. And why not? The initial law carried a daily fine of $10,000 for noncompliance, a penalty that’s only grown through cost of living adjustments to $25,561 a day.
